WELD Summary

WELD is the Tema U.S. Manufacturing & Reshoring ETF, focused on American industrial companies that are bringing factories and jobs back to the U.S. It doesn’t track a traditional index, but follows the reshoring theme, holding firms that support local production and supply chains. Well-known names include Caterpillar and Eaton, along with other machinery and materials companies. Investors might consider WELD for growth potential tied to U.S. manufacturing and for diversification within industrial and related sectors. A key risk is that it’s heavily concentrated in industrial stocks, so its value can rise or fall sharply with the manufacturing economy.
How much will it cost me?The Tema American Reshoring ETF (RSHO) has an expense ratio of 0.75%, which means you’ll pay $7.50 per year for every $1,000 invested. This is higher than average because it is actively managed, focusing on a specific niche within the industrial sector to capitalize on reshoring trends.
What would affect this ETF?The Tema American Reshoring ETF (RSHO) could benefit from trends like increased government support for domestic manufacturing, supply chain shifts favoring local production, and advancements in industrial technology. However, it may face challenges from rising interest rates, which can increase borrowing costs for industrial companies, or economic slowdowns that reduce demand for manufacturing investments. Its focus on U.S. industrials and top holdings like Caterpillar and Rockwell Automation makes it sensitive to both policy changes and broader economic conditions in the U.S.
